Laurel Man Arrested After 2 Roommates Stabbed, 1 Fatally: Police
A Laurel man has been arrested after his 2 roommates were found stabbed, including 1 fatally, police report.
LAUREL, MD — A Laurel man has been arrested after police say he stabbed two of his roommates, one fatally.
On Aug. 12 around 9:28 p.m., Laurel police officers were called to the 15000 block of Laurel Oaks Lane for a report of a stabbing. Officers found two individuals in the street with severe stab wounds, according to a police report. Terrence Smith Jr., 51, died at the scene. Aiden Smith, 20, is listed in stable condition, according to police.
An investigation indicated that the suspect, who was a roommate of the victims, was still inside the property, police reported. Officers secured the scene and took the suspect, Kevin Raymond Nicholas Green, 34, into custody without incident.

Green has been charged with first-degree murder. Police continue to investigate the incident.
